package pack1;
import java.util.*;
public class ex2 {
public static void main(String[] args) {
Scanner input=new Scanner(System.in);
System.out.print("请输入您要判断的年份:");
int year=input.nextInt();
System.out.print("请输入您要判断的月份:");
int m=input.nextInt();
switch (m){
case 1:System.out.print(m+"月份有:31天");break;
case 3:System.out.print(m+"月份有:31天");break;
case 4:System.out.print(m+"月份有:30天");break;
case 5:System.out.print(m+"月份有:31天");break;
case 6:System.out.print(m+"月份有:30天");break;
case 7:System.out.print(m+"月份有:31天");break;
case 8:System.out.print(m+"月份有:31天");break;
case 9:System.out.print(m+"月份有:30天");break;
case 10:System.out.print(m+"月份有:31天");break;
case 11:System.out.print(m+"月份有:30天");break;
case 12:System.out.print(m+"月份有:31天");break;
case 2:{if (year%400==0||(year%4==0&&year%100!=0))System.out.print(m+"月份有:29天");else System.out.print(m+"月份有:28天");break;}
default:System.out.print("对不起,您输入的月份有误!");}
}
}

package pack1;
import java.util.*;
public class ex2{public static void main(String[] args) {Scanner sc=new Scanner(System.in);int y=0;int n=0;//输入年份,用于判断闰年!System.out.println("请输入年份:");y = sc.nextInt();System.out.println("请输入月份:");n =sc.nextInt();switch(n){case 1:case 3:case 5:case 7:case 8:case 10:case 12:System.out.println(n+"月份有:31天");break;//对于2月份需要判断是否为闰年case 2:if((y%4==0 &&y % 100 != 0) || (y % 400 == 0)) {System.out.println(n+"月份有:29天");break;}else{System.out.println(n+"月份有:28天");break;}case 4:case 6:case 9:case 11:System.out.println(n+"月份有:30天");break;default:System.out.println("请输入正确的年份和月份");break;}}
}

用java语言编写程序,从键盘输入一个年份(如2016年)和一个月份(如2月),输出该月的天数相关推荐

  1. 输入三角形的三c语言程序,请问c语言中 从键盘输入三角形的3边 调用三角形面积公式求面积 并输.,C语言编写程序,从键盘输入三角形三条边长(实数),计算并输出...

    导航:网站首页 > 请问c语言中 从键盘输入三角形的3边 调用三角形面积公式求面积 并输.,C语言编写程序,从键盘输入三角形三条边长(实数),计算并输出 请问c语言中 从键盘输入三角形的3边 调 ...

  2. C语言编写程序,从键盘输入三角形的三条边,判断它们是否能构成等腰或直角三角形。

    编写程序,从键盘输入三角形的3条边a.b.c, 判断它们是否能构成等腰或直角三角形,如果能,则输出yes,如果不能,则输出NO. 实验代码: #include <stdio.h> int ...

  3. 3.12 编写程序从键盘输入一个整数,计算并输出该数的数字之和。例如:请输入 一个整数:8899123 各位数字之和为:40

    package booksTest;import java.util.Scanner;public class p54_3_12 {public static void main(String[] a ...

  4. 用java语言编写程序计算九宫图

    前言 对于程序员来说,用程序解决数学问题是最有趣的事情之一.本人研究了一个能够轻易计算九宫图的算法,并且用java语言编写程序得以实现.现将算法和代码公布,欢迎广大程序爱好者前来阅读.交流. 九宫图简 ...

  5. 定义一个表示教师的结构体变量,教师信息包含:编号,姓名,年龄,职称。编写程序从键盘输入一个教师的信息,然后将该教师的信息显示在屏幕上。

    定义一个表示教师的结构体变量,教师信息包含:编号,姓名,年龄,职称.编写程序从键盘输入一个教师的信息,然后将该教师的信息显示在屏幕上. 解析: #include <stdio.h>type ...

  6. C语言-编写程序,根据输入的学生成绩给出相应的等级,大于或等于90分以上的等级为A,60分以下的等级为E,其余每10分为一个等级。(switch语句)

    用switch语句改写C语言-编写程序,根据输入的学生成绩给出相应的等级,大于或等于90分以上的等级为A,60分以下的等级为E,其余每10分为一个等级.(else if语句) #include< ...

  7. java输入两个整数_求平均值._用C语言编写:完成从键盘输入两个整数a和b,求平均值ave,并输出平均值...

    #includevoid main(){int a,b,ave;printf("输入两个整数:');scanf("%d%d",&a,&b);ave=(a+ ...

  8. 用c语言编写线反转法键盘输入,电子密码锁的方案设计书与实现[1]

    <电子密码锁的方案设计书与实现[1]>由会员分享,可在线阅读,更多相关<电子密码锁的方案设计书与实现[1](21页珍藏版)>请在技术文库上搜索. 1.沈阳理工大学创新实践周课程 ...

  9. 公民身份号码是一种由18位数字组成的特征组合码,其排列顺序从左至右依次为:6位数字地址码、8位数字出生日期码,3位数字顺序码和1位数字校验码(校验码若为10则用字符X来表示)。编写程序从键盘输入一个

    #include <stdio.h> int main() {int add,year,month,day;/*定义地址码,年月日*/int shunxuma;/*定义顺序码*/char ...

  10. 编写程序,要求输入三角形的三条边,计算三角形的面积并输出

    # -*- codeing = utf-8 -*- # @Time : 2021/12/23 8:57 # @Author : wjm # @File : demo1.py # @Software: ...

最新文章

  1. 《BREW进阶与精通——3G移动增值业务的运营、定制与开发》连载之31---LBS基于BREW的位置服务...
  2. node2vec: Scalable Feature Learning for networks
  3. IDA Pro动态调试Android so文件
  4. c语言基础回顾 —— 其他知识点
  5. Spring再次涵盖了您:继续进行消费者驱动的消息传递合同测试
  6. android菜单详解二:选项菜单
  7. 读书笔记——第八周学习笔记
  8. 02C++namespace命名空间
  9. Axure Share ——原型设计工具 Axure ,移动版
  10. 自由软件之“父”—Richard. M. Stallman
  11. poj3537 Crosses and Crosses 博弈论
  12. 简述你对人工智能未来发展的看法?
  13. linux中常用的压缩命令,Linux中常用的压缩和解压缩命令汇总
  14. Mobile(3)-攻防世界-APK逆向
  15. ios 仿电脑qq登录界面_iOS开发UI篇—模仿ipad版QQ空间登录界面-阿里云开发者社区...
  16. BAT超级入口“连接”战
  17. 一文学会LaTeX基础
  18. RTSP/RTP/RTCP协议流程及分析
  19. 微积分基础知识note
  20. 激动我心的感觉――我的○五年元月求职经历[ZT]

热门文章

  1. [C语言]行列式计算器
  2. 独一无二的出现次数-哈希表1207-python
  3. 状态机架构 例3包文类型识别
  4. 三种快速转换PDF为TXT的方法:简单、高效、免费
  5. PHP判断是否移动端访问
  6. 错误:internal error. please refer to https://jb.gg/ide/critical-startup-errors 的处理
  7. python实现播放音乐_Python实现小小音乐播放器
  8. 国产深度Linux(deepin)操作系统
  9. iPhone/iTouch/iPad不越狱也能修改应用的好工具
  10. android sqlite 创建空表,sqlite3在android中创建表错误(sqlite3 create table error in android)...